How much do data analyst internship j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 3, 2026, the average hourly pay for data analyst internship in High Point, NC is $20.08,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.43 and $21.88 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a data analyst internship?

A Data Analyst Internship is a temporary position where interns gain hands-on experience in collecting, organizing, and analyzing data to support business decisions. Interns typically work with large datasets, use tools like Excel, SQL, and Python, and create reports or visualizations. The role helps develop technical skills, analytical thinking, and an understanding of how data-driven insights impact an organization. It is a great opportunity for students or recent graduates to apply theoretical knowledge in a real-world setting.

What typical projects or responsibilities might I have as a data analyst intern?

As a Data Analyst Intern, you'll likely work on tasks such as cleaning and organizing raw data, running analysis to identify trends or patterns, and assisting with the creation of reports and data visualizations for your team. You may collaborate closely with senior analysts or cross-functional teams to support ongoing projects and business initiatives. Interns commonly get exposure to real-world datasets, participate in team meetings, and sometimes contribute to presentations or process improvement efforts. This hands-on experience is designed to help you develop both your technical and analytical skills while gaining insight into the role of data in business decision-making.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in a data analyst internship,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Data Analyst Intern, you need a solid grounding in statistics, data interpretation, and problem-solving, often backed by coursework or a degree in fields like mathematics, computer science, or economics. Familiarity with tools such as Microsoft Excel, SQL databases, and data visualization software like Tableau or Power BI is highly valuable. Attention to detail, effective communication, and a willingness to learn are essential soft skills for success in this position. These competencies are crucial for accurately analyzing data, drawing insights, and clearly presenting findings to support business decisions.

Qorvo's Data Analytics Internships are offered in our High Performance Analog, Advanced Cellular, and Connectivity and Sensors business groups. Specific projects and responsibilities will be determined based on the business needs at the time of the internship assignment.

Responsibilities:

  • Assist in collecting, cleaning, and preprocessing large datasets from various sources
  • Perform exploratory data analysis to identify trends, patterns, and insights
  • Support the development and validation of predictive models and machine learning algorithms
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to understand data needs and deliver actionable insights
  • Create clear visualizations and reports to communicate findings effectively
  • Document methodologies and maintain data pipelines and workflows

 

Qualifications:

  • Currently pursuing a degree in Data Science, Computer Science, Statistics, Mathematics, Engineering, or a related field
  • Basic knowledge of programming languages such as Python or R
  • Prior experience with SQL and data visualization tools (e.g., PowerBi, DataBricks, Spotfire) is a plus
  • Familiarity with data analysis libraries (e.g., pandas, NumPy, scikit-learn)
  • Understanding of statistical concepts and machine learning fundamentals
  • Strong problem-solving skills and attention to detail
  • Good communication skills and ability to work collaboratively in a team environment
